引言

随着互联网和移动互联网的快速发展,用户界面(UI)设计在产品开发中扮演着越来越重要的角色。优秀的UI设计不仅能够提升用户体验,还能增强产品的市场竞争力。本文将从UI设计的理论基础出发,深入探讨实战过程中的关键环节,旨在帮助设计师们更好地理解和应用UI设计技巧。

一、UI设计的基本理论

1.1 设计原则

  • 一致性:界面元素在大小、颜色、字体等方面保持一致,使用户能够快速识别和记忆。
  • 对比:通过颜色、字体、大小等手段,使重要信息突出,提高可读性。
  • 对齐:保持界面元素的对齐,使界面看起来整洁有序。
  • 重复:重复使用元素,增强界面风格的一致性。
  • 亲密性:将相关元素放置在一起,提高信息组织性。

1.2 用户体验(UX)设计

  • 目标用户:明确目标用户群体,了解他们的需求和行为习惯。
  • 用户研究:通过问卷调查、访谈等方式收集用户反馈,优化设计。
  • 原型设计:制作原型,模拟用户使用场景,测试设计方案。

二、UI设计实战流程

2.1 需求分析

  • 产品定位:明确产品的功能和目标。
  • 用户画像:根据用户需求和行为习惯,绘制用户画像。
  • 竞品分析:分析竞品优缺点,为自身设计提供参考。

2.2 设计工具

  • Sketch:适用于移动端和网页端的设计工具,界面简洁,功能强大。
  • Adobe XD:跨平台设计工具,支持原型设计和交互设计。
  • Figma:基于浏览器的协作设计工具,支持多人实时协作。

2.3 设计规范

  • 色彩搭配:遵循色彩理论,选择合适的颜色搭配。
  • 字体选择:选择易于阅读的字体,注意字体大小和行间距。
  • 图标设计:简洁明了,符合产品风格。

2.4 设计稿制作

  • 页面布局:遵循设计原则,合理安排页面元素。
  • 细节处理:注意界面细节,如按钮、输入框等元素的交互效果。
  • 动画设计:合理运用动画效果,提升用户体验。

2.5 测试与优化

  • 用户测试:邀请目标用户进行测试,收集反馈意见。
  • 数据分析:分析用户行为数据,优化设计方案。

三、案例分析

3.1 案例一:某电商APP

  • 设计亮点:简洁的页面布局,丰富的商品分类,流畅的购物流程。
  • 优化建议:增加个性化推荐功能,提升用户粘性。

3.2 案例二:某教育APP

  • 设计亮点:清晰的课程结构,丰富的学习资源,良好的用户体验。
  • 优化建议:优化课程推荐算法,提高用户满意度。

四、总结

UI设计是一项综合性技能,需要设计师具备扎实的理论基础和丰富的实战经验。本文从理论到实操,全面解析了UI设计的关键环节,旨在帮助设计师们更好地提升自己的设计能力。在实际工作中,设计师应根据产品特点和用户需求,灵活运用设计技巧,打造出优秀的UI作品。